Local Pros / Pennsylvania / Bensalem
Plumbers in Bensalem, PA
24 local plumbers serving Bensalem and the surrounding area. Bensalem is a smaller city where most pros also serve nearby towns. See typical Pennsylvania costs and a free DIY-or-hire breakdown before you reach out. We never sell your info and never take kickbacks.
Population
~60,427
Pros within 35 mi
24
Nearest listed
5 mi
Typical water heater replacement cost in Pennsylvania: hiring runs $1,200–$3,500, DIY about $600–$1,700. Calibrate it to Bensalem before you call.
Plumbers near Bensalem
Carney All Seasons
Plumber · Southampton, Pennsylvania · 6 mi
A&S Drain Cleaning
Plumber · Levittown, Pennsylvania · 7 mi
City Plumbing of South Jersey
Plumber · Cinnaminson, New Jersey · 7 mi
Express Drains
Plumber · Warminster, Pennsylvania · 10 mi
Baxter's Appliance Repair
Plumber · Philadelphia, Pennsylvania · 10 mi
Inter-County Oil Services and Building Inspectors & Contractors
Plumber · Glenside, Pennsylvania · 11 mi
Rydal Fuel Heating and Air Conditioning
Plumber · Glenside, Pennsylvania · 11 mi
City Plumbing
Plumber · Philadelphia, Pennsylvania · 12 mi
Mini Backhoe Services
Plumber · Oreland, Pennsylvania · 13 mi
Greater Works Plumbing
Plumber · Philadelphia, Pennsylvania · 13 mi
Hertler Plumbing & HVAC
Plumber · Fort Washington, Pennsylvania · 14 mi
Cardwell HVAC & Plumbing
Plumber · Cherry Hill Township, New Jersey · 14 mi
Anyzek Plumbing
Plumber · Gloucester City, New Jersey · 17 mi
Vaughan Comfort Services
Plumber · Magnolia, New Jersey · 18 mi
Holmes Management Co.
Plumber · Philadelphia, Pennsylvania · 19 mi
Permits & rules in Pennsylvania
Permit rules for water heater replacement vary by city and county in Pennsylvania. Most structural, electrical, plumbing, or mechanical work needs a permit and an inspection. Confirm with your local building department, or see the Pennsylvania guide for specifics. Varies by municipality Pennsylvania water heater replacement costs are calibrated from the national average using Pennsylvania's regional price parity (0.97) and local labor index (1.00).
See Pennsylvania permit details →Plumbers in Bensalem: common questions
How much does it cost to hire a plumber in Bensalem, Pennsylvania?
In Pennsylvania, water heater replacement typically runs $1,200 to $3,500 when you hire a pro, and about $600 to $1,700 if you do it yourself. Bensalem prices track the Pennsylvania range, with larger metros toward the high end. Size it to your own home with our free calculator.
Do I need a permit for water heater replacement in Pennsylvania?
Permit rules for water heater replacement vary by city and county in Pennsylvania. Most structural, electrical, plumbing, or mechanical work needs a permit and an inspection. Confirm with your local building department, or see the Pennsylvania guide for specifics. Varies by municipality Always confirm with the Bensalem or Pennsylvania building department before work begins.
Should I DIY or hire a plumber in Bensalem?
Water heater replacement is rated moderate for a DIYer. Doing it yourself can save the gap between $600 to $1,700 and $1,200 to $3,500, but plumbers bring tools, permits, and a warranty. For a large or time-sensitive job, a local pro in Bensalem is usually the safer call. Our free DIY-or-hire calculator walks through it.
How many plumbers serve Bensalem?
We currently list 24 plumbers within about 35 miles of Bensalem, the nearest about 5 miles out. We never sell your information and never take kickbacks.